Having just gone and checked the Source Of All Knowledge, I discovered that our price hike was steep, but gradual over the past 10 years. When I got my first passport in 2000, it was £28. Now, whether you're first time or renewing, passports in the UK are £77.50 (~$116). If you're renewing your passport and you want it done in a hurry, it's £112.50 (~$170) for the one week service, or £129.50 (~$195) for the one day service. Normal passport service is ~3 weeks.
